Medical Housing

The Office of Campus Life makes all room assignments. When students are ill or disabled in any way, the Trinity College Health Center may be asked to assess the nature and severity of the illness or disability and recommend (temporary or permanent) special housing accommodations. The Health Center may choose to recommend single rooms or special room assignments only upon adequate documentation of absolute medical necessity (see Medical Housing form below).

Procedure:

A student seeking a recommendation from the Health Center for a special room assignment for medical reasons must bring or have sent a report from his/her own primary care physician documenting the medical history and outlook for recovery. A simple request from a physician is insufficient to provide special accommodations. The Health Center may request additional consultation prior to making any recommendation. The Director of the Health Center agrees that a special room assignment is warranted, the following will occur:

  • An assessment of necessity will be made
  • A priority category assigned
  • A formal recommendation will be filed with the Office of Residential Life

The Categories of priority are as follows:

Priority 1 - such an assignment is deemed essential to health and well being

Priority 2 - such an assignment is deemed helpful in maintaining health and well being

Priority 3 - such and assignment is deemed a simple aid in maintaining health

Upon receipt of this recommendation, the Office of Residential Life will make a determination of whether or not the suggested medical accommodation will be granted to the student. This decision is based upon the availability of space and the needs of the student and the College.
